Praktikum Query Select MySQL
Apakah anda sedang mencari bagaimana implementasi Query Select pada MySQL. Pelajari cara merancang query yang tepat untuk mengekstraksi data dari basis data, mulai dari konsep dasar hingga teknik penggabungan tabel. Praktikum ini menyajikan contoh data dan query SELECT yang relevan dengan fokus pada keyword "Praktikum Query Select MySQL." Tingkatkan pemahaman Anda tentang pengambilan data yang efisien dan kuat untuk meningkatkan kinerja aplikasi dan analisis data.
Praktikum Query Select Menggunakan Database MySQL
Daftar Isi :
- Apa itu Query Select
- Struktur Dasar Perintah SELECT
- Penggunaan Operator Logika Query SELECT
- Pengurutan dan Pengelompokan Query Select (ORDER and GROUP)
- Penggabungan Tabel Dengan Join
1. Apa itu Query SELECT
Perintah SELECT merupakan perintah yang sangat penting dalam SQL untuk mengambil dan menampilkan data dari database (Raharjo, 2011). Dengan perintah SELECT, kita dapat mengambil baris-baris data dari satu tabel atau lebih.
2. Struktur Dasar Perintah SELECT
Contoh query diatas untuk mengambil semua data dalam tabel.
SELECT * FROM pelanggan;
Bagaimana jika ingin mengambil kolom tertentu saja dari table yang ada?
SELECT nama, alamat * FROM pelanggan;
Bagaimana jika perlu kondisi tertentu? kita dapat menggunakan WHERE. Berikut merupakan struktur dasar nya :SELECT column1, column2, ...
FROM table_name
WHERE condition;
Pada query diatas artinya kita ingin menampilkan data dari column1 dan column2 dari table tertentu dengan kondisi tertentu.
Bagaimana jika di implementasikan pada table pelanggan?
SELECT nama, alamat
FROM pelanggan
WHERE alamat='Jakarta';
Pada query diatas artinya kita ingin menampilkan data dari nama dan pelanggan dari table pelanggan dengan kondisi alamat berada di Jakarta.
2. Penggunaan Operator Logika Query SELECT
Operator yang digunakan disini adalah AND dan OR. Operator AND akan menghasilkan nilai TRUE jika kedua kondisi nya terpenuhi, sedangkan operator OR akan menghasilkan TRUE jika salah satu nya terpenuhi. Sedangkan operator NOT akan terpenuhi jika kondisi tidak sama dengan.
Contoh Penggunaan Operator AND
- Contoh 1: Menampilkan Pelanggan dari Jakarta yang Memiliki Email
SELECT *
FROM pelanggan
WHERE Kota = 'Jakarta' AND Email IS NOT NULL; - Contoh 2: Menampilkan Pesanan dengan Jumlah Lebih dari 2 dan Kurang dari 5
SELECT *
FROM pesanan
WHERE Jumlah > 2 AND Jumlah < 5;
Contoh Penggunaan Operator OR
- Contoh 1: Menampilkan Pelanggan dari Jakarta atau Surabaya
SELECT * FROM pelanggan WHERE Kota = 'Jakarta' OR Kota = 'Surabaya';
- Contoh 2: Menampilkan Pesanan dengan Jumlah Kurang dari 3 atau Lebih dari 5
SELECT * FROM pesanan WHERE Jumlah < 3 OR Jumlah > 5;
Contoh Penggunaan Operator NOT
- Contoh 1: Menampilkan Pelanggan yang Bukan dari Jakarta
SELECT * FROM pelanggan WHERE NOT Kota = 'Jakarta';
- Contoh 2: Menampilkan Pesanan dengan Jumlah Bukan 4
SELECT * FROM pesanan WHERE NOT Jumlah = 4;
Contoh Kombinasi Operator
- Contoh 1: Menampilkan Pelanggan dari Jakarta dengan Email atau Pelanggan dari Surabaya tanpa Email
SELECT * FROM pelanggan WHERE (Kota = 'Jakarta' AND Email IS NOT NULL) OR (Kota = 'Surabaya' AND Email IS NULL);
- Contoh 8: Menampilkan Pesanan dengan Jumlah Lebih dari 3 atau Kurang dari 2, kecuali yang memiliki OrderID 105
SELECT * FROM pesanan WHERE (Jumlah > 3 OR Jumlah < 2) AND NOT OrderID = 105;
3. Pengurutan dan Pengelompokan Query Select (ORDER and GROUP)
- Berikut merupakan contoh pengurutan data dari yang terkecil - terbesar, berdasarkan umur menggunakan Ascending atau ASC.
SELECT * FROM tabel_user ORDER BY umur ASC;
- Berikut merupakan contoh pengurutan data dari yang terbesar - terkecil, berdasarkan umur menggunakan Descending atau DESC.
SELECT * FROM tabel_user ORDER BY umur DESC;
- Berikut adalah contoh untuk pengelompokan data atau penggunaan GROUP BY pada query SQL.
SELECT nama_kolom, COUNT(*) FROM nama_tabel GROUP BY nama_kolom;
4. Penggabungan Tabel Dengan Join
Pada kesempatan ini kita akan mencoba untuk SELECT query untuk menggabungkan dua tabel menggunakan Join. Namun ini hanya basic dan pembahasan detail di artikel yang berbeda.
- Penggunaan Inner Join
SELECT * FROM tabel1 INNER JOIN tabel2 ON tabel1.id = tabel2.id;
- Penggunaan Left Join atau Right Join
SELECT * FROM tabel1 LEFT JOIN tabel2 ON tabel1.id = tabel2.id;
SELECT * FROM tabel1 RIGHT JOIN tabel2 ON tabel1.id = tabel2.id;
Kesimpulan
Pemahaman yang mendalam tentang perintah SELECT dalam MySQL adalah kunci untuk mendapatkan informasi yang dibutuhkan dari basis data. Praktikum dan latihan dalam panduan ini akan membantu Anda memperkuat keterampilan SQL Anda. Jangan ragu untuk terus eksplorasi dan tingkatkan pemahaman Anda dalam menggunakan perintah SELECT untuk mengambil data secara efisien.
Tag Penelusuran:
- Operator Logika SQL:
SQL Logic Operators
SQL AND Operator
SQL OR Operator
SQL NOT Operator
Penggunaan Operator AND dalam SQL:
SQL AND Operator Examples
SQL AND Operator Syntax
Using AND in SQL Queries
Penggunaan Operator OR dalam SQL:
SQL OR Operator Examples
SQL OR Operator Syntax
Using OR in SQL Queries
Kombinasi Operator Logika dalam SQL:
Combining AND and OR in SQL
SQL Complex Conditions
SQL Multiple Conditions
Contoh Query SELECT MySQL:
MySQL SELECT Query
SQL SELECT Statement Examples
Practical SELECT Queries in MySQL
Pemfilteran Data dengan SQL:
Filtering Data in SQL
SQL WHERE Clause
SQL Query Filtering Techniques
Praktikum SQL:
SQL Practice Exercises
SQL SELECT Practice
MySQL Query Practice
Belajar SQL untuk Pemula:
SQL Basics for Beginners
Introduction to SQL
Learning SQL Step by Step
Optimasi Query MySQL:
MySQL Query Optimization
Improving SQL Query Performance
Tips for Efficient SQL Queries
Panduan Penggunaan SELECT dalam SQL:
Guide to Using SELECT in SQL
SQL SELECT Statement Guide
Mastering SQL SELECT Queries
Posting Komentar untuk "Praktikum Query Select MySQL"